Two glass towers — Oasis and Nirvana — overlook a vast central pool deck dotted with cabanas, food trucks and a stage that hosts live music every weekend. Hard Rock Hotel Tenerife is the antidote to old-world resort hush; it's unapologetically loud, fashionable and fun. Inside, the rooms are sleek and tech-forward, with in-room sound systems and a curated music library. The Rock Spa offers a unique 'Rhythm and Motion' massage synced to a personalised playlist. Two pools, six restaurants and a beach club below complete the picture. Adults-only Nirvana tower is the better choice for couples; Oasis welcomes families and gets livelier. Best for travellers in their 20s–40s who want a luxury beach holiday with a built-in nightlife.
